Event description

Felicity McCallum will continue our Mini-Conference theme with a Theology and Peace Quarterly Speakers’ Series talk on “Stories of Creative Mimesis and Gentle Action in the Australian Context: First Contact and Today.” Felicity is an Awabakaleen (female of Awaba) active in her community as a spiritual leader, teacher, and advocate for Indigenous issues. She is a leading public voice in Australia on matters of Indigenous life and Christianity/religion. Q&A will follow.
